The Business Problem

Roaming failures don't show up in coverage maps. They show up mid-workflow.

Coverage maps show where signal exists. They don't show where roaming fails, where handoffs drop, or where a device stubbornly holds onto a distant access point when a better one is nearby.

For staff who move constantly — pushing carts, moving between floors, covering large areas — roaming performance is the real measure of wireless reliability. This assessment tests it the way operations actually experience it.

Example Finding

One finding, read three ways.

Every finding descends from business impact to engineering evidence — so leadership, operations, and engineers each see the layer that speaks to them.

Layer 1 · Business Impact · Leadership

Staff experience connectivity drops when moving between zones, disrupting time-sensitive workflows.

Layer 2 · Operational Cause · Management

Roaming events between floors and in high-density corridors result in session drops.

Layer 3 · Engineering Evidence · Technical

Sticky client behavior observed — devices holding associations at −80 dBm when −65 dBm APs available within 15m.

Remediation Roadmap

Sequenced for impact, kept at the executive level.

Phase 010–30 days

Immediate

Tune roaming aggressiveness thresholds and eliminate sticky-client conditions in highest-traffic corridors.

Phase 021–3 months

Near-Term

Redesign AP placement at floor transitions and high-density areas to eliminate roaming dead zones.

Phase 03Ongoing

Strategic

Implement 802.11r/k/v where supported and establish roaming performance baselines for ongoing validation.
